Fatality involving a track-mounted excavator, Evandale, Tasmania, on 20 July 2022
RO-2022-008

Summary
The ATSB is investigating an accident involving a track-mounted excavator at Evandale, Tasmania, on the morning of 20 July 2022.
Workers were conducting track maintenance on Tasmania’s South Line when a track-mounted excavator toppled onto its side while lifting a rail maintenance trailer. The vehicle’s operator was fatally injured, and another worker sustained minor injuries.
The evidence collection phase of the investigation will include examination of the accident site and wreckage, and the collection of other relevant evidence, including interviews with key involved parties and witness reports.
Should a critical safety issue be identified during the course of the investigation, the ATSB will immediately notify relevant parties so appropriate safety action can be taken.
A final report will be released at the conclusion of the investigation.
